Same problem here, only I had nvidia-glx-legacy installed (NVIDIA NV25, Geforce4 TI4200) and it stopped working. the X.log file said something about "no working modes", it failed to detect my two 19" screens' DDC settings (ie. refresh rates etc), and so refused to go up in 1280x1024, only offered 800x600, which wasn't a mode I configured.

I installed nvidia-glx instead, which worked right out of the box with the old config.
